Merck & Co., Inc. (NYSE:MRK - Get Free Report) was the target of some unusual options trading on Tuesday. Investors purchased 68,419 call options on the stock. This represents an increase of 68% compared to the typical daily volume of 40,831 call options.
Merck & Co., Inc. Stock Up 6.8%
NYSE:MRK traded up $5.38 during trading hours on Tuesday, hitting $83.96. The company's stock had a trading volume of 21,624,017 shares, compared to its average volume of 15,028,813. The stock has a market capitalization of $209.71 billion, a P/E ratio of 12.94,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 0.81 and a beta of 0.37. The stock has a fifty day moving average of $82.51 and a 200-day moving average of $81.69. The company has a current ratio of 1.42, a quick ratio of 1.17 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.69. Merck & Co., Inc. has a 52-week low of $73.31 and a 52-week high of $114.79.
Merck & Co., Inc. (NYSE:MRK -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, July 29th. The company reported $2.13 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$2.03 by $0.10. The company had revenue of $15.81 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$15.92 billion. Merck & Co., Inc. had a return on equity of 41.05% and a net margin of 25.79%. Merck & Co., Inc. has set its FY 2025 guidance at 8.870-8.970 EPS. On average, equities analysts forecast that Merck & Co., Inc. will post 9.01 earnings per share for the current year.
Merck & Co., Inc. Announces Dividend
The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, October 7th. Shareholders of record on Monday, September 15th will be issued a dividend of $0.81 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Monday, September 15th. This represents a $3.24 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 3.9%. Merck & Co., Inc.'s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 49.92%.

Merck & Co, Inc is a health care company, which engages in the provision of health solutions through its prescription medicines, vaccines, biologic therapies, animal health, and consumer care products. It operates through the following segments: Pharmaceutical, Animal Health, and Other. The Pharmaceutical segment includes human health pharmaceutical and vaccine products.
